The phrase "prioritizing the objective"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when discussing the importance of focusing on a specific goal or aim in a project or task. Example: "In our strategy meeting, we emphasized prioritizing the objective to ensure that all team members are aligned with our main goals."

Linguistic Context
The phrase "prioritizing the objective" functions as a gerund phrase, often serving as the subject or object of a sentence. It describes the act of assigning importance or precedence to a specific goal or aim. Ludwig AI indicates that this phrase is grammatically sound and usable.

FAQs
How to use "prioritizing the objective" in a sentence?
You can use "prioritizing the objective" to emphasize the importance of focusing on a specific goal. For example, "In our strategy meeting, we emphasized "prioritizing the objective" to ensure that all team members are aligned with our main goals."
What can I say instead of "prioritizing the objective"?
You can use alternatives like "focusing on the goal" or "emphasizing the aim" depending on the context.
Is "prioritizing the objective" grammatically correct?
Yes, "prioritizing the objective" is grammatically correct. It uses the gerund form of the verb "prioritize" to describe the act of making the objective a priority.
What does "prioritizing the objective" mean?
"Prioritizing the objective" means giving the objective precedence or greater importance compared to other considerations. It involves deciding which goal or aim is most crucial and focusing efforts accordingly.
